IT科技

问题描述:在 Python 中是什么%s意思?下面的代码有什么作用?例如... if len(sys.argv) < 2: sys.exit('Usage: %s database-name' % sys.argv[0]) if not os.path.exists(sys.ar...
  131  
问题描述:我正在使用 Pandas 数据框,并希望根据现有列创建一个新列。我还没有看到关于df.apply()和之间的速度差异的很好的讨论np.vectorize(),所以我想在这里问一下。Pandasapply()函数很慢。根据我的测量结果(如下所示的一些实验),使用np.vectorize()比...
  162  
问题描述:在 Python 中使用链表的最简单方法是什么?在 Scheme 中,链表的定义很简单'(1 2 3 4 5)。事实上, Python 的列表[1, 2, 3, 4, 5]和元组(1, 2, 3, 4, 5)并不是链表,链表具有一些不错的特性,例如常量时间连接,以及能够引用其中的不同部分。...
  121  
问题描述:我正在尝试使用 显示灰度图像matplotlib.pyplot.imshow()。我的问题是灰度图像显示为颜色图。我需要它是灰度的,因为我想用颜色在图像上绘制。我读入图像并使用 PIL 将其转换为灰度Image.open().convert("L")image = Im...
  117  
问题描述:我想要一种在 Python 中实现“计算器 API”的简单方法。现在我不太关心计算器将支持的具体功能集。我希望它接收一个字符串,然后"1+1"返回一个带有结果的字符串,在我们的例子中"2"。有没有办法确保eval这样的事情是安全的?首先,我会env ...
  112  
问题描述:在 Python 中,你可以在列表推导中拥有多个迭代器,例如[(x,y) for x in a for y in b] 对于一些合适的序列 a 和 b。我知道 Python 列表推导的嵌套循环语义。我的问题是:理解中的一个迭代器可以引用另一个迭代器吗?换句话说:我是否可以有这样的事情:[x...
  115  
问题描述:据我了解:解释型语言是一种由解释器(将高级语言转换为机器代码然后执行的程序)随时运行和执行的高级语言;它一次处理一点程序。编译型语言是一种高级语言,其代码首先由编译器(将高级语言转换为机器代码的程序)转换为机器代码,然后由执行器(运行代码的另一个程序)执行。如果我的定义错误,请纠正我。现在...
  148  
问题描述:我有一个文件,它可能位于每个用户机器的不同位置。有没有办法实现对文件的搜索?有没有办法可以传递文件的名称和目录树进行搜索?解决方案 1:os.walk是答案,这将找到第一个匹配:import os def find(name, path): for root, dirs, fil...
  150  
问题描述:是否有内置/快速的方法使用字典中的键列表来获取相应项目的列表?例如我有:>>> mydict = {'one': 1, 'two': 2, 'three': 3} >>> mykeys = ['three', 'one'] 如何使用mykeys列表获取字...
  132  
问题描述:我想使用 Python 的 webdriver 以其默认配置文件启动 Chrome,以便 cookie 和站点首选项在会话之间保持不变。我怎样才能做到这一点?解决方案 1:这最终使它对我有用。from selenium import webdriver options = webdriv...
  180  
621/996
热门文章
项目管理软件有哪些?
曾咪二维码

扫码咨询,免费领取项目管理大礼包!

云禅道AD
禅道项目管理软件

云端的项目管理软件

尊享禅道项目软件收费版功能

无需维护,随时随地协同办公

内置subversion和git源码管理

每天备份,随时转为私有部署

免费试用